Early producing, bush type variety with medium-sized pods of delicate, buttery flavored lima beans. Great for steaming, freezing, sauteing, grilling and canning and can be dried.

Plant in enriched garden soil 1-2 weeks after last frost. Leave 12" of space between each plant. Fertilize when transplanting and when beans are about to bloom. Provide a trellis to support growing plants. Water early morning or late evening.
